The Edwin B. Forsythe National Wildlife Refuge

📍 Galloway Township, New Jersey

You drive along the winding road through untouched landscapes, the call of wild birds echoing around you. With every glance, nature unveils its treasures, hinting that peace is never far away.

Located between Atlantic City and Ocean City, this wildlife refuge offers a serene escape with over 47,000 acres of protected habitats, perfect for spotting migratory birds and other local wildlife. The sight of egrets, herons, and more makes it feel like a hidden sanctuary.

Explorer Tip

Visit in early morning for the best wildlife sightings.
